Hi Waddler, I have now downloaded and installed SP1 a total of 13 times!!!!
I have used both methods: via windows update and via the microsoft downloads.
When I have downloaded it via the microsoft website downloads, it downloads fine but when it comes to the next step, install, I get the message 'Serive Pack 1 is already running'.
Two seconds after I have tried to download and install SP2 via the microsoft website, it downloaded and then I get the message 'not able to install.'
When I look at my list of updates on my computer it lists the sucessful 13 downloads of SP1 but my computer is still asking me 'to install a very important update Sevice Pack 1'.
I have also run the microsoft 'Fix it' programme for 'troubleshooting problems with downloads'.I have done this two times but it has made no difference.

    Magenta, start your own new thread with the following logs & let's see if we can work out what's going on.

    Download DDS from the link below and save it to your desktop:

    Link


    After you've downloaded it and saved it to your desktop:
    • Double click DDS to run it.
    • When it's finished, DDS will open two logs:
    1. DDS.txt
    2. Attach.txt
    Save both reports to your desktop.

    Copy & paste the contents of both logs and post them in the new thread. (you may need to split the log over separate posts)

    Also download this file and save it somewhere you can easily find it, but don't run it yet - start the new thread first.

    SP1 definitely isn't installed. Download the System Update Readiness Tool for Windows Vista from the link above if you haven't already and then run that. Then try to install SP1 again.
